Orth: “All This Love Has Helped Protect Us”
The Today show ‘s Matt Lauer interviewed Maureen Orth this morning about her September Vanity Fair cover story of French first lady Carla Bruni-Sarkozy.
The interview marked the first television interview for Orth since the death of her husband Tim Russert last month. After discussing the feature story, Lauer turned his attention to Tim.
“We’re doing great,” said Orth. “We have received so much love and concern from everyone, starting with you guys at NBC.”
Orth joked about some of the surprising coverage after Russert’s death. “You have to know his People Magazine cover knocked off the Summer’s Hottest Bachelors,” she said. “He broke the Britney Spears record for most hits on People.com. This would make Tim so happy, make him laugh so hard.”
